Transaction d1b3feca6f217b0b963305adfc837c89b014ed04509505332e76c9bec764d176
1 Input
1 Output
-
d1b3feca6f217b0b963305adfc837c89b014ed04509505332e76c9bec764d176:0
- value
- 9016186
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8de522bdbf704160cbd224c162abb6e30cfdb28 OP_EQUAL
- address
- 3MTiD7S9t38i6sxU5y7bowVymYwCzusZKi